Javascript 如何在HTML/CSS经过一定时间后淡入并淡出div

Javascript 如何在HTML/CSS经过一定时间后淡入并淡出div,javascript,html,jquery,css,Javascript,Html,Jquery,Css,我有一个包含文本的div,经过一段时间后,我希望该div淡出,然后另一个div淡入。我试过这个,第二个div不会消失: $(函数(){ $(“.preload”).fadeOut(20,函数(){ $(“.content”).fadeIn(20); }); }) 第一页 第二页 您可以先将.contentdiv设置为显示:none,然后将.preload设置为fadeOut() 另外,您添加的seconds过低div无法显示其fadeIn或fadeOut效果。至少使用相当于2秒淡出效果的20

我有一个包含文本的div,经过一段时间后,我希望该div淡出,然后另一个div淡入。我试过这个,第二个div不会消失:

$(函数(){
$(“.preload”).fadeOut(20,函数(){
$(“.content”).fadeIn(20);
});
})

第一页
第二页

您可以先将
.content
div设置为
显示:none
,然后将
.preload
设置为
fadeOut()

另外,您添加的
seconds
过低
div无法显示其
fadeIn
fadeOut
效果。至少使用相当于
2
秒淡出效果的
2000

现场演示:

$(函数(){
$(“.preload”).fadeOut(2000,函数(){
$(“.content”).fadeIn(2000年);
});
});
.content{
显示:无;
}

首页
第一页
第二页

你真的忠于你的头衔啊哈,非常感谢你。我最初想做的是制作一个进度条,或者在一段时间后,或者当进度条达到100时转到另一个网页。但是现在有了这个,我可以把第一页的内容放在一个div中,第二页的内容放在另一个div中,然后像上面那样做。谢谢again@kayacancode很高兴听到:)总是乐于助人,乐于编码!